Output 59d591a675a913de5107ad5d80c3290c4e04d279635c65926c09fd1a93a22d56:17

value
376724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ba2b30e37a63b0087b246727ccbedc8c9bc6b2a OP_EQUAL
address
3CxjwhCRtZe2pPu7CK6WSvKLdMBhyBVbwU
transaction
59d591a675a913de5107ad5d80c3290c4e04d279635c65926c09fd1a93a22d56
spent
true